Transaction 95220ccfcf6888f03f758a20497f6c9dc161c2ab2fc00cc8e223833af8bbb630
1 Input
1 Output
-
95220ccfcf6888f03f758a20497f6c9dc161c2ab2fc00cc8e223833af8bbb630:0
- value
- 177293
- script pubkey
- OP_0 OP_PUSHBYTES_32 57c6d6c4350ac91200f30310d5955b831b46dc5abebd5f31c48b917fa035bf62
- address
- bc1q2lrdd3p4pty3yq8nqvgdt92msvd5dhz6h6747vwy3wghlgp4ha3qvds5gp